Avellino Mayor Resigns and is Arrested for Corruption

The former mayor of Avellino, Gianluca Festa, has been arrested as part of an investigation for embezzlement and undue inducement to give and promise benefits. He has been placed under house arrest along with an architect, Fabio Guerriero, the brother of a municipal councilor, and a municipal manager. The Carabinieri, working on behalf of the Avellino prosecutor’s office, have also conducted searches on other individuals connected to Festa, including the deputy mayor, Laura Nargi, and the councilor Diego Guerriero. The investigation centers around the Serie B basketball team that Festa was involved with, with suspicions of a criminal association arising from sponsorships obtained from companies that had contracts with the Avellino Municipality.

Gianluca Festa, a basketball enthusiast, was elected mayor of Avellino in June 2019. The investigation into his activities intensified when his home and office were searched by the Avellino prosecutor’s office. Festa’s involvement with the city’s basketball team, struggling after a bankruptcy, has come under scrutiny. In a bid to save basketball in Avellino, Festa had personally contributed funds to ensure the registration of an Irpinia team in the Serie B championship. Now, Festa faces house arrest and investigation for potential corruption, criminal association, public disturbance, and forgery of public documents.

Festa has maintained his innocence, claiming that the investigations will lead to nothing. He has expressed confidence that the truth will come to light and that he and his associates are innocent. Despite the ongoing legal proceedings, Festa remains committed to defending himself and his reputation amidst the unfolding scandal.
